summaryrefslogtreecommitdiffstats
path: root/debian/patches/tests-configuration.patch
blob: d331d063eb28fd4f15c38f261e461a4884de68c5 (plain)
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
From: Dmitry Shachnev <mitya57@debian.org>
Date: Fri, 29 Jun 2018 16:58:36 +0300
Subject: Make it possible to run upstream tests

- Do not use readthedocs-sphinx-ext, it is not packaged.
- Point to local version of sphinx_rtd_theme.
---
 tests/util.py | 5 ++---
 1 file changed, 2 insertions(+), 3 deletions(-)

diff --git a/tests/util.py b/tests/util.py
index c9fdcc1..38fe839 100644
--- a/tests/util.py
+++ b/tests/util.py
@@ -34,8 +34,8 @@ def build(root, builder='html', **kwargs):
     confoverrides['html_theme'] = 'sphinx_rtd_theme'
     extensions = confoverrides.get('extensions', [])
     extensions.append('sphinx_rtd_theme')
-    extensions.append('readthedocs_ext.readthedocs')
     confoverrides['extensions'] = extensions
+    confoverrides['html_theme_path'] = [os.path.abspath('../../..')]
     kwargs['confoverrides'] = confoverrides
 
     try:
@@ -55,7 +55,6 @@ def build(root, builder='html', **kwargs):
 
 
 def build_all(root, **kwargs):
-    for builder in ['html', 'singlehtml', 'readthedocs', 'readthedocsdirhtml',
-                    'readthedocssinglehtml', 'readthedocssinglehtmllocalmedia']:
+    for builder in ['html', 'singlehtml']:
         with build(root, builder, **kwargs) as ret:
             yield ret